CVE-2023-31115

CVE-2023-31115 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 7.5/10 on the CVSS scale. An issue was discovered in the Shannon RCS component in Samsung Exynos Modem 5123 and 5300. Incorrect resource transfer between spheres can cause changes to the activation mode of RCS via a crafted application.. EPSS estimates a 0.49%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.

Affected Software
| Vendor | Product | Versions |
|---|---|---|
| Samsung | Exynos 5123 Firmware | All versions |
| Samsung | Exynos 5300 Firmware | All versions |
